
metaENGINE, the first-of-its-kind infrastructure platform with its own game engine, today announced the successful completion of its first $4 million Seed round. The round was co-led by Lemniscap and Jump Crypto with participation from Polygon Studios, Blockwall, blufolio, Insignius Capital, Future Fund, CoinDCX Ventures, Efficient Frontier, Maelstrom and other leading VC funds and prominent angels.
The $4 million raised from these marquee investors will assist in further development of the metaENGINE platform ahead of its upcoming v1 release, slated to launch during early Q3, 2022. Over 25 GameFi projects are set to join the platform at its launch, with more details to be unveiled in the coming weeks.

metaENGINE builds upon two decades of experience in the development and deployment of massive multiplayer online (MMO) game engine HeroEngine. This expertise in operating a leading real-time, scalable, and cloud-based development platform secured successful licensing agreements with Electronic Arts to develop “Star Wars: The Old Republic”, Zenimax to develop “The Elder Scrolls Online”, and several other MMO projects.

metaENGINE provides developers with a comprehensive suite of tools to build and publish massive multiplayer online GameFi projects from scratch, mint NFTs, and in the future migrate games from other platforms, and more. Owing to metaENGINE’s unique real-time collaborative environment, multiple developers and content creators can simultaneously develop their games anywhere in the world. In addition, the platform will deliver gaming guild analytics and management tools, native multi-blockchain compatibility with Ethereum, Polygon, Solana, and others. A multi-chain tooling suite with SDKs, wallets, NFT marketplace and transactional layer is being built to be ready at launch.
Importantly, metaENGINE addresses one of the most critical, yet seldom discussed challenges related to blockchain gaming — asset interoperability. Games developed on metaENGINE will feature not just multi-chain compatibility but also multi-game functionality, enabling items to be used across multiple game environments – this is fundamental to the creation of a true open metaverse gaming experience.
Current blockchain gaming tools are still relatively rudimentary. The incorporation of Web3 elements such as play-to-earn or NFTs requires games to have a substantial amount of external infrastructure that is not available on any single platform. Other platforms looking to embrace blockchain features have typically opted to provide blockchain Software Development Kits (SDKs), as is the case with Forte and Enjin, but this still requires additional integration work.
Counted among metaENGINE’s multi-chain integrations is the Polygon Network. Polygon enables a sustainable base of operations for game developers to mitigate the prohibitive gas fees associated with the Ethereum main chain.

About Lemniscap
Lemniscap is an investment firm specialising in investments in emerging crypto assets and blockchain startups. Since its founding in 2014, Lemniscap has funded multiple investments in the crypto blockchain space, on the core belief that blockchain technology will upend traditional business models, resulting in profound changes in the world economy.
The Lemniscap team consists of talented people with backgrounds in financial markets, PE/VC, technology and entrepreneurship.
